We meet Miss Margerethe as a substitute teacher for an hour. An hour in which she can be the ruler of the world all by herself, over everything and everyone, and she makes the most of it. This is an hour on her terms... "Miss Margerethe" is based on the play "Apareceu a Margarida" by Roberto Athayde. Spillebrikkene has created its own version of this play. Inger Gundersen is the director and Hedda Munthe plays Miss Margerethe. Through humor, absurd situations and physical comedy, we want to convey the seriousness that lies in this play. "Miss Margerethe" is a performance that addresses issues of authority, abuse of power and manipulation. Everywhere, people are subdued and manipulated by power-hungry authorities; in families, in workplaces, in the media and in societies ruled by dictators. We hope the performance can help create debates, provoke, stir, maybe even get someone to stand up against this injustice and madness that exists everywhere. The performance is well suited as a starting point for further conversation and discussion.
